Yair Bartal
August 18, 2015 at 6:16 pmThanks David.
I’ve already checked Adobe minimum requirements page.
Both versions require the same minimum CPU, however CS5 requires 2 GB ram whereas CC 2014.1 requires 4 GB ram.
So on the face of it, CS5 will run better with 4 GB ram.
On the other hand CC 2014.1 may have more efficient algorithms and certainly more and easier options.
